So how do you find the right mix?

1
Cover your essentials with income you can't outlive.

Layer Social Security, pension, and potentially a SPIA until your non-negotiable monthly expenses are covered — regardless of what the market does.

2
Keep the rest invested for growth and flexibility.

Savings above the guaranteed floor stay in your portfolio — funding lifestyle spending, travel, generosity, and legacy with room to grow.

3
Optimize the split for your life.

Too much guaranteed income and you lose liquidity. Too little and your essentials ride the market. The right balance depends on your age, health, spending, risk tolerance, and goals.
